
Cancer Council - Hope Ball
For the Cancer Council's 30th Anniversary event, I was tasked with creating a logo and comprehensive branding strategy. The goal was to honor the organization's legacy while effectively communicating its mission to raise funds for cancer research and support.
I began by developing a unique logo that encapsulated the essence of the Cancer Council and the significance of their 30-year milestone. The design process involved thorough research into the organization's history and values, ensuring the final logo was both meaningful and visually impactful.
Following the logo creation, I crafted a cohesive branding strategy that included selecting a color palette and typography that conveyed a sense of hope and community. These elements were designed to be used across various platforms, from event materials to digital media, ensuring a consistent and powerful visual identity.
To bring the branding to life, I coordinated and directed a series of photography sessions, capturing images that reflected the spirit of the Cancer Council and its beneficiaries. This included working with photographers to set up impactful shots, selecting appropriate props, and ensuring the overall styling was in line with the brand’s message.
The project culminated in the development of a suite of branded materials for the anniversary event, including brochures, banners, and social media graphics. My role extended to overseeing the production of these materials, ensuring high-quality outputs that stayed true to the brand’s new identity.
This project allowed me to showcase my skills in logo design, branding, and project management, resulting in a cohesive and inspiring brand identity that honored the Cancer Council’s 30-year commitment to the fight against cancer.
